I don’t really want to say too much about the love of my life on the internet. ( Some things you got to keep private) but I really felt that I should share this.
This past Valentine ’s Day I received the most beautiful and most special gift I have ever received from anyone. A promise ring. No not an engagement ring. Just a promise ring!
Like our parents used to have when there was still such a thing as trying to win and keep her heart. These days it’s all about show, saying I love you in the first week, and breaking up in the third. I don’t mean to brag but I feel that lately it is a very big accomplishment to actually make a relationship work for more than a year. People have changed, times have changed and the words I LOVE YOU is just something we say to make the relationship “mean more”, it is just something for the show.
People always ask me how do you make it work? To be honest there is not just one thing to make it work. It takes hard work, understanding and most important not giving up even when times get hard. But more on how we make it work later.
This ring is so special to me because it shows me everything that I have wondered about. How much does he love me? Does he want to spend the rest of his life with me?
(Just to put you at ease, we have been dating for three years so it is not weird to think about stuff like this)
I wonder what happened to boys treating girls like princesses. What happened to tradition. What happened to couples still giving each other butterflies! It is fantastic to be able to say that after three years I am still so in love with this man. That every time he kisses me I still feel like a love sick teenager.
This little ring have so many hidden promises buried in it and I will not take it off until my engagement ring replaces it. So ladies, if you find a man like mine, who still believes in tradition and believe that treating a lady like a princes is not a blessing but the way it should be. Then keep him and make sure that you are the best that you can be. Be the one he deserves to have.
